Antibody Discovery: Illuminating The trail to Precision Medication
Antibodies, the immune method's all-natural protection against pathogens, have very long been harnessed for their therapeutic opportunity. Right now, developments in antibody discovery methods, including phage Show and hybridoma engineering, are enabling scientists to engineer antibodies with unparalleled precision and specificity. By concentrating on precise illness markers or antigens, these engineered antibodies maintain huge guarantee for that diagnosis and remedy of assorted illnesses, together with cancer, autoimmune Diseases, and infectious ailments.

Nanobody Growth: Groundbreaking Precision Medication Answers
Nanobodies, the smallest useful antibody fragments derived from camelid antibodies, depict a promising class of biologics with special Homes and programs. Due to their tiny measurement, robust steadiness, and significant affinity for concentrate on antigens, nanobodies give quite a few strengths about typical antibodies, like improved tissue penetration, diminished immunogenicity, and Improved manufacturability. Because of this, nanobody improvement has emerged as a vital place of target inside the biopharmaceutical business, with opportunity programs starting from specific drug shipping and delivery and imaging to diagnostics and therapy.
